Best practice review of workplace health and safety in the Northern Territory: final report


The Northern Territory government has released this six-month review of the Territory’s workplace regulator, NT WorkSafe. The review examined present policies, procedures and activities, and considers how best practices can be implemented to support staff and the industry.

The shorter working week: a radical and pragmatic proposal


This paper aims to demonstrate that the time we spend in work is neither natural nor inevitable. One of the central aims of this paper is to establish time itself as a site of political contestation – in the same vein as housing, healthcare, income, and national defence.

Understanding insecure work in Australia


This discussion paper outlines the nature of insecure work in Australia. It defines how we got here, and what the impact of such widespread workplace insecurity is on Australia’s workers and its economy.

Building bridges to work


The Given the Chance for Asylum Seekers program acted as a ‘bridge’ to employment for asylum seekers, circumventing some of the challenges of constrained visa conditions and barriers in mainstream recruitment. This final report examines the employment trajectories of program participants.
